The Portsmouth area has a population of 215,000 people. When broken down by age group, 20-39 year olds represent the largest portion of the population. The 4.1% unemployment rate among the 106,700 economically active people in the area is in line with the national average. Salaries in Portsmouth average £25,913 a year, while in the United Kingdom the average salary is just over £30,500.

If you'd like to run your own Takeaway business, Bagel Corner might be a great option for you. There are 30 locations open so far, and the network is expanding. You will need to invest in a small premises to operate this business.
Another possibility to consider is Wolf. This brand is developing, counting four outlets in the UK. You will need to invest £200,000 to start operating your own Wolf business, which is a substantial initial investment. Your personal investment should account for at least £100,000 of the total amount. Due to the higher startup costs, this option is not recommended for first-time franchisees. A large premises will also be required to operate this business. If you choose to invest in this franchise, financial aid is available, providing you meet the eligibility criteria.
Finally, Rooster Shack is another successful brand operating in the Takeaway services sector. By joining its current two franchisees, you would become a part of a growing brand network. This business opportunity requires a substantial initial investment of £150,000. You could get a loan to help cover startup costs, in which case your personal investment will usually need to cover 30 to 50% of the total investment. Rooster Shack asks for a minimum personal investment of £75,000. Given these higher startup costs, this opportunity is less suitable for first-time franchisees.
